Shake Them All! is a live wallpaper using realistic physics engine and g-sensors to display Androids falling down your screen.
Androids react to gravity, touching, shaking your phone and even light and sound now.

Concerning pixels on the edge, this is due to the Android image I used that had a blue background.
I made the background transparent, but had to remove some pixels that were a bit blue. Hence the pixaleted edges.
I'll try finding another pic.

Guidelines:
- The PNG is 294x294 with transparencies.
- Clock face, background and uh... other stuff should fit inside 280x280 (or inside a circle that is 280 across).
- Hands should be in separate graphics (minute, hour) and the pin/center needs to be centered on 147x147.
- I can send some layered guides in layered Gimp (.xcf) or separated into separate PNG format if needed.

Thank you for info,
changing configuration (choosing new pictures) randomly can cause FC,
it is quite rare so it will take me some time to investigate it.
Wallpapers are working except of that so I will focus on finding this bug in config.
Transition fade speed will be added soon - it's good suggestion.
EDIT: found issue: bitmap memory size seems to be too big sometimes for the system.
i will take care of it.
Till now if you have FC in config just reopen settings and uncheck and then check back: "Show background image".
